Fits into one slot on the Agilent i3070 utility card Frequency counter on all I/O pins – Frequency input up to 200 MHz Adjustable signal slew rate and drive strength
It is also possible to use JTAG to program devices while performing ICT to increase throughput.Programming speeds close to the theoretical maximum of a device can be achieved using the advanced features of the XJLink2 3070. Reduced stages and increased throughputThe XJLink2 3070’s capability to combine test and programming allows a reduction in the number of stages and handling operations on a production line. In addition, I☬, SPI and other manufacturer-specific protocols can be driven as part of test and programming operations. More than JTAGThe interface of the XJLink2 3070 is completely configurable and can be used for more than JTAG. Advanced auto-skew control enables use of the JTAG chain at the maximum frequency, while the configurable voltage levels allow direct connection to most JTAG chains. Advanced connectivityThe XJLink2 3070 has variable signal slew rate and drive strength so it can handle boards either with or without signal termination.
